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
005218926 0017932 379567
48 3238 56161569598
48 3238 56161569598
18408 1367292 5045054138 782547542
All about undefined
Interested in learning more?
48 3238 56161569598
18408 1367292 5045054138 782547542
See more
2545316 21650397666
841 09273 0615537
See more
050353687 2914004 5248034
07 65201243 88378571 8813
See more